Chen Cheng was a famous General of the Kuomintang, who participated in the encirclement and suppression of the Central Soviet Region many times, and fought with many Red Army generals, including many marshal-level figures, but it was a general who made him remember for a lifetime.

This admiral is Li Jukui, who is not as famous as Xu Shiyou, but his ability is very good. During the fifth counter-encirclement and suppression campaign, Li Jukui commanded 1 regiment, but blocked Chen Cheng's 3 divisions, forcing him to retreat, and it was this battle that made Chen Cheng remember him.

A native of Hunan, Li Jukui joined the Pingjiang Uprising led by Mr. Peng in 1928 at the age of 24 and joined the Communist Party of China at the behest of Mr. Peng. During the agrarian revolution, he served as a platoon leader, regimental commander, division commander and other positions.

He was experienced in hundreds of battles, participated in five anti-encirclement and suppression battles, and at the beginning of the Long March, he was the commander of the Red First Division of the Red First Army, opening the way for the Red Army in the front, and commanding the 18 warriors of the Red Regiment to complete the arduous task of crossing the Dadu River.

Li Jukui was very low-key, and although he made great achievements in this battle, he never showed off. Even if a reporter took the initiative to ask, he also said that the credit should be credited to the heads of all soldiers, and the spirit of the Red Army should be passed on forever.

Elder Peng was always a big man in our army, and Li Jukui saved his life, but almost everyone didn't know it. After the victory of the Pingjiang Uprising, the team was divided, and at a meeting, someone shot and shot Mr. Peng.

If it had been hit at that time, it is estimated that history would have been rewritten, Li Jukui found out that the first time to throw people down, the bullet was crooked, Mr. Peng was fine, it was considered to have saved his life.

Most of the people present at that time later died in the battle, or Mr. Peng said it, and others knew about it, and saving Mr. Peng was more credited than fighting 10 battles.

After the outbreak of the Anti-Japanese War, Li Jukui served as chief of staff in the 386th Brigade of the 129th Division of the Eighth Route Army, and participated in the command of many beautiful battles, such as the Battle of Shentouling, using the tactic of "throwing eggs with stones" to eliminate 1500 enemies in 2 hours.

In 1942, the Japanese army divided its troops into 14 routes, attacked the Taiyue Military Region, and occupied Qinyuan County, the center of the Yuebei Military Sub-district. Li Jukui carried out the "empty room clearance" in advance, and the Japanese army occupied an empty city, and he immediately sent troops to besiege the city. The Japanese army had no food and grass and no reinforcements, so it directly surrendered.

During the Liberation War, Li Jukui was in the northeast battlefield, serving as the chief of staff of the Western Manchuria Military Region, serving as a staff officer to General Huang Kecheng, and even Lin Shuai, commander-in-chief of The Four Fields, knew his name, and was later transferred to the Logistics Department of the Northeast Military Region as chief of staff.

After the start of the War to Resist US Aggression and Aid Korea, the main dry food of the volunteer army was fried noodles, so why did fried noodles become the dry food of the volunteers' field battles? The Korean battlefield is icy and snowy, and it is very difficult to supply materials, and fried noodles were invented by Li Jukui. When participating in the Long March, the Red Army's supplies were also difficult, and he often ate the fried noodles given to him by the common people, which were easy to preserve and easy to carry, so he researched the field dry food.

With Li Jukui's seniority and merits, he fully met the criteria of the founding general, but in 1955 he was serving as the minister of petroleum industry, and could not award titles, only 3 first-class medals.

In 1958, he was transferred back to the army and awarded the rank of founding general, the last general to be awarded.

In July 1981, Li Jukui's health was not good, so he retired to the second line and became an adviser to the Central Military Commission, but also actively participated in the army and national defense construction. In 1988, he was awarded the Medal of Merit of the Red Star first class and died of illness at the age of 91.
